You will find the authentic generosity and lightness of Italian Prosecco. Produced with Glera grapes and fermented in an autoclave according to the Charmat Method, it gives off refreshing aromas of crisp apple, lemon zest and a touch of mint and basil. Its juicy sips are reminiscent of a refreshing homemade lemonade, enriched with a soft carbonic and a fruity and balsamic finish.

It is the perfect option to enjoy seafood, fresh cheeses and crunchy vegetable appetizers. Combine it with Venetian “cicchetti”, a typical appetizer of cod, roasted tofu with peanuts, dim sum, chickpea cream tacos with avocado and cilantro. Fantastic with falafel, white asparagus with “cacio e pepe” sauce, mussels gratin with parmesan and sea bass tartar on mozzarella and ginger cream.
